Output 153ebef32026b62014dbf2689eb6e5fd8a25e76f4e4e168ebf629aea0bc37396:1

value
132343
script pubkey
OP_0 OP_PUSHBYTES_20 d2a86c7eadedbcb953d2289e491559e3ef3ee731
address
bc1q625xcl4dak7tj57j9z0yj92eu0hnaee3nrv5lp
transaction
153ebef32026b62014dbf2689eb6e5fd8a25e76f4e4e168ebf629aea0bc37396
confirmations
38518
spent
true